The main differences between truffle and white wine

  • Truffle is richer than white wine in fiber, manganese, selenium, iron, vitamin B2, vitamin B3, phosphorus, potassium, copper, and magnesium.
  • Daily need coverage for fiber for truffle is 280% higher.
  • Truffle contains 434 times more selenium than white wine. Truffle contains 43.4µg of selenium, while white wine contains 0.1µg.
  • White wine has a lower glycemic index than truffle.
